description 8 1/2 Overview

8 1/2 is Federico Fellini's 1963 Italian film about a blocked director, noted for its self-reflexive structure and Academy Award for Best Foreign Language Film.

help 8 1/2 FAQ

What does the title 8 1/2 refer to in Fellini's film?

The title points to Federico Fellini's count of his own films up to that point, with some earlier co-directed or shorter work counted as half. The 1963 film turns that self-reference into the story of Guido Anselmi, a blocked director played by Marcello Mastroianni.

Is 8 1/2 about making a science-fiction movie?

Partly, but the unfinished science-fiction project is mainly a pressure point for Guido's creative crisis. The huge launch-pad set in 8 1/2 becomes a symbol of a film that has grown too large for its director to explain.

Who are the women Guido keeps thinking about in 8 1/2?

The key figures include Luisa, played by Anouk Aimee, Claudia, played by Claudia Cardinale, and Carla, played by Sandra Milo. Fellini mixes Guido's marriage, affairs, childhood memories, and fantasies instead of keeping them in separate realistic scenes.

Did 8 1/2 win an Oscar?

Yes. Federico Fellini's 8 1/2 won the Academy Award for Best Foreign Language Film, and it also won for black-and-white costume design.
